Diocesan Synod of the Diocese in Europe 2022

For the first time since 2019 (because of the coronavirus pandemic), the diocesan synod of the Diocese in Europe met at the Kardinal-Schultehaus in Cologne in the first week of June (Diocesan Synod - Diocese in Europe (anglican.org) ). The Chaplain-President was present as the diocese's Living in Love and Faith advocate (Living in Love and Faith | The Church of England ). During synod, Bishop Robert commissioned the Revd Dr Catriona Laing (priest-in-charge of St Martha and St Mary Leuven) as assistant dean of women's ministry in the diocese, alongside Canon Debbie Flach (chaplain of Christchurch Lille) as dean of women's ministry (Diocese appoints Dean and Assistant Dean of Women's Ministry - Latest News (anglican.org) ). The synod was a very happy time of friendship and community after the privations and sufferings of the pandemic.

New Second Secretary on the Central Committee

The Central Committee is extremely grateful to Minister Van Quickenborne for granting a stipend for a Second Secretary to help the Chaplain-President and the Secretary in the exercise of their responsibilities towards the Belgian public authorities as well as towards the Anglican canonical authorities and Belgian Anglicans in general. On 3 May, M. Charles Melebeck began work in this role. We wish him a warm welcome!

Couloirs humanitaires/Humanitaire corridors

On 5 May, the Chaplain-President attended a meeting of the Humanitarian Corridors Task Force hosted by Sant'Egidio Belgium (Couloirs humanitaires : Sant’Egidio dresse un premier bilan - Sant' Egidio (santegidio.be) ). In 2019, Humanitarian Corridors Belgium, supported by the Recognised Convictions, brought 150 Syrian refugees, both Christians and Muslims, into safety in Belgium. The Anglican parish in Gent hosted one family. Despite the ongoing refugee crisis for Ukrainians, Humanitarian Corridors hopes to bring 250 Syrian refugees to safety in Belgium during 2022-2023.

Meeting with the Bishops' Conference in Belgium

On 12 May, Bishop Robert and the Chaplain-President were honoured to be invited, along with the presidents of the Orthodox, Protestant and Evangelical Churches in Belgium, to a special meeting of the Conférence des Evêques de Belgique/Bischoppenconferentie van België at the Archbishop's Palace in Malines/Mechelen. They discussed Pope Francis' plans for a Synod of Catholic Bishops to meet in 2023 to discuss the Church and synodality. The meeting was followed by a delightful supper.

Meeting with Government of Brussels Capital Region about Ukrainian refugees

On 28th April, the Chaplain-President participated in a Zoom meeting of the presidents of the recognised life stances with M. Pierre Verbeeren (the coordinator for Ukraine) and his team from the Brussels Regional Government, to discuss practical options for helping the 20,000 Ukrainian refugees expected to be in Brussels soon, to find meals, housing, education and integration into Belgian society, as well as pastoral and spiritual support.
